Well I can understand your concerns.But I need to know few other things/evaluations to give better suggestions.
1) The time since you are trying for a baby.
2) What is your cycle length, period of flow, whether associated with pain
3)Is there any suggestive past history like TB,endometriosis.
3)relevant investigation reports-hormone profile,(DAY 3, FSH, LH, ESTRADIOL),diagnostic hysterolaparoscopy,
4) What is the report of the semen analysis of your husband
5)What is the number of cycles of ovulation induction done with documented follicle rupture? What is the number of cycles of IUI done before IVF etc.
6) What are the IVF parameters like stimulation drugs,follicles retrieved ,embryo quality,day of transfer,and embryo preservation done if any.
To stamp it as UNEXPLAINED infertility,most of the investigations need to be normal.
In those cases please go for repeat IUI cycles on 3 to 4 occasions before going for further IVF.

I can assume from your answers that she most probably has an unexplained infertility. One of the important investigations you have not mentioned is whether she has undergone Diagnostic hysterolaparoscopy (DHL). I think it is a very pertinent investigations in the sense that it will provide you with a array of robust information regarding
1)the uterine cavity,
2)the tubal patency
3)the pelvis, the tuboovarian relationship etc(every detail is not visible by ultrasound)
So, if DHL has not been done please proceed for it under a good infertility specialist.
If it is normal, then proceed for ovulation induction and IUI.
